草庐IT

iphone - 尝试构建非临时版本时出现 Entitlements.plist 错误?

我四处寻找答案,但没有找到答案......我成功构建了此应用的临时版本,但现在当我尝试针对调试、发布或常规分发进行构建时,出现构建错误:“CodeSign错误:权利文件‘/Users/Dropbox/myApp/Entitlements.plist’丢失”事情是a)entitlements.plist文件就在资源文件夹中b)这甚至不是xcode项目文件夹的正确路径。c)我从项目设置>构建>代码签名权利中删除了key,那么为什么它还要寻找entitlements.plist?这是怎么回事??我怎样才能让xcode停止尝试查找权利文件,我知道它甚至不需要临时构建以外的任何东西。

ios - 从 plist 中检索数据

我有一个plist,里面有一个数组,然后是一组字典元素?如何将数据从plist检索到我的数组?如何在一个数组中获取类别名称? 最佳答案 objective-C//ReadplistfrombundleandgetRootDictionaryoutofitNSDictionary*dictRoot=[NSDictionarydictionaryWithContentsOfFile:[[NSBundlemainBundle]pathForResource:@"data"ofType:@"plist"]];//Yourdictionary

ios - 如何在plist中写入数据?

我已经按照这个答案将数据写入plistHowtowritedatatotheplist?但到目前为止,我的plist根本没有改变。这是我的代码:--(IBAction)save:(id)sender{NSString*path=[[NSBundlemainBundle]pathForResource:@"drinks"ofType:@"plist"];NSString*drinkName=self.name.text;NSString*drinkIngredients=self.ingredients.text;NSString*drinkDirection=self.directio

iphone - 选择 info.plist 文件

我已经本地化了我的Info.plist文件,因为我必须为不同语言的应用程序使用不同的名称。因为我这样做了,项目窗口显示了这个按钮:选择info.plist文件。如果我单击此按钮,将弹出一个没有任何选择的窗口。更糟糕的是,该项目将无法编译,并给出错误error:couldnotreaddatafrom'/Users/user/Documents/myApp/Info.plist':Thefile“Info.plist”couldn'tbe因为没有这样的文件而打开。事实上,消息是正确的,因为Xcode将其从该位置删除,并将Info.plist的副本添加到每个本地化目录(en.lproj、P

ios - XCode 6.0.1 Enterprise In House Distribution 不创建 ipa/plist

升级到XCode6.0.1后,InHouseEnterpriseDistributionfromArchive现在会创建一个.pkg文件而不是.ipa/.plist文件。这打破了我们的企业分配系统。我还没有找到关于此更改的任何文档。有没有人对此有任何见解? 最佳答案 在选择Archivenow之前,将“ApplicationsupportsiTunesfilesharing”值YES或“LSRequiresIPhoneOS”值YES添加到info.plist中。它将使用xcode6.0.1构建ipa

ios - 使用 plist 文件在 iPhone/iPad 上安装应用程序时如何正确显示图标和进度?

我在自己的AppStore网站上工作,该网站为一家公司托管各种企业应用程序。到目前为止,一切正常,除了建议的在Apple设备上下载应用程序的方式。问题是,我存档的效果与从官方AppleAppStore安装的应用程序不同。在安装应用程序之前,我在主屏幕上看不到应用程序的图标,并且在下载应用程序时我看不到任何进度,只有在安装应用程序时才看到。应用程序本身可以下载和安装。当一个人选择将应用程序下载到他/她的iPhone时,会重定向到itms链接,如下所示:itms-services://?action=download-manifest&url=https://example.org/app

ios - 无法下载 GoogleService-Info.plist 文件

我正在按照说明here尝试为我的新iOS应用程序设置GoogleAnalytics(分析).它指示我单击“获取配置文件”按钮,但该按钮只是将我发送到另一个旋转的页面,什么也没有发生。我已经在Analyticsforweb中设置了媒体资源,并为移动设备设置了View。任何人都可以与我共享GoogleService-Info.plist文件,以便我可以尝试手动填写文件的详细信息并将其添加到我的项目中吗? 最佳答案 我也遇到过。如果您关闭所有内容并点击该链接,下次它对我有用。你可以尝试这样做。下面是示例plist文件的链接,当然我将跟踪I

ios - 获取info.plist的fileSize,防止盗版

我正在尝试将反盗版代码放入我的应用程序中。之前对此的回答(由于我的成员(member)身份,我无法链接到-糟透了)可以很容易地反驳,因为可以使用十六进制编辑器在二进制文件中查找和替换“SignerIdentity”字符串。相反,检查info.plist文件的文件大小并将其与引用值进行比较听起来更可靠(因为在破解应用程序时info.plist会在这里和那里被修改)。我该怎么做?我尝试了以下但它记录了0。NSBundle*bundle=[NSBundlemainBundle];NSDictionary*mainDictionary=[bundleinfoDictionary];NSLog(

ios - Info.plist 格式不正确

我在我的iOSXcode项目中工作得很好,然后当我试图运行它时突然间,我开始收到以下错误:error:couldn'tparsecontentsof'/Users/pavitarsidhu/Desktop/AmigoDash/SidebarDemo/AmigoDash-Info.plist':Thedatacouldn’tbereadbecauseitisn’tinthecorrectformat.我真的很困惑。我查看了过去的StackOverflow问题,但仍无法解决此问题。无论如何只生成一个新的信息列表?大家怎么看? 最佳答案

ios - PhoneGap 缺少 plist.key

当我尝试将我的iTunes应用程序安装程序上传到iTunes时,我消除了这个错误:MissingInfo.plistkey-Thisappattemptstoaccessprivacy-sensitivedatawithoutausagedescription.Theapp'sInfo.plistmustcontainanNSPhotoLibraryUsageDescriptionkeywithastringvalueexplainingtotheuserhowtheappusesthisdata.MissingInfo.plistkey-Thisappattemptstoaccess